Pedestrian Dies After Hit-and-Run in Lexington County

By Personal Injury Lawyer on October 4, 2011

A pedestrian died after being struck by a car Saturday night in an hit-and-run incident in Lexington County, report news sources.

According to the Lexington County Coroner’s Office, the 26-year-old Leesville man was walking along Pond Branch Road when, at approximately 11:15 p.m., he was struck by a vehicle near Reedy Smith Road, roughly 11 miles west of Lexington. The man was transported to a Columbia hospital where h was declared dead.

The vehicle that hit the pedestrian was a Ford Crown Victoria that fled the scene after the incident, reports the South Carolina Highway Patrol. A 20-year-old Saluda man has been charged with hit-and-run involving a death, according to the Highway Patrol.
